Honor is gearing up to launch its next flagship series, the Honor 100 lineup. The series is expected to consist of three models: the Honor 100, Honor 100 Pro, and the Honor 100 GT.

While the official launch date is still unknown, some details about the devices have been leaked online.

According to the 3C certification, two (2) Honor 100 series smartphones, with model numbers MAA-AN10 and MA-AN00, will support 100W fast charging and 5G connectivity.

It's a significant upgrade from the previous Honor 90 series, which offered up to 66W (Honor 90) and 90W (Honor 90 Pro) charging.

The Honor 100 series is also rumored to feature a 1.5K resolution display with a high refresh rate and high frequency dimming for eye protection.

The devices are likely to be pow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 SoC, which is the latest flagship chipset from the Qualcomm.

The Honor 100 series is also expected to sport dual front-facing cameras and a circular rear camera module, which could be similar to the Honor 90 series.

Honor has not yet confirmed the launch date of the Honor 100 series, but it is speculated that it could happen by the end of November.
